OUR IMPACT

Goldman Sachs Asset Management is one of the world's leading investment managers and provides institutional and individual investors with investment and advisory solutions, with strategies spanning asset classes, industries, and geographies. We help our clients navigate today's dynamic markets and identify the opportunities that shape their portfolios and long-term investment goals. We extend these global capabilities to the world's leading pension plans, sovereign wealth funds, central banks, insurance companies, financial institutions, endowments, foundations, individuals and family offices.

The Client Coverage Group (CCG) within Asset Management is dedicated to servicing and supporting existing client relationships by ensuring exceptional client service, operational support, and risk management, while also looking for opportunities to expand the relationship. This involves partnering closely with the sales team, keeping them abreast of recent interactions with clients, and collaborating with portfolio management and operations teams to address client queries.

HOW YOU WILL FULFILL YOUR POTENTIAL

  • Contribute to a broad platform that serves as the client's main point of contact for a diverse set of functional areas, including Portfolio Management, Trading, Operations, Legal, and Compliance
  • Provide a superior level of service across all aspects of client experience, including management of client inquiries, ad hoc issue resolution, and enabling customized and standardized report delivery
  • Help coordinate life-cycle events of client accounts, including implementation of new business, account restructures/terminations, and impact from regulatory changes. Requires managing tasks across various teams including Strategic Client Services, Client Implementation, Portfolio Management, Trading, Operations, Controllers, Risk Management, Legal, Compliance, and Accounting/Billing
  • Work on special projects that build out the service model and infrastructure to create scale and efficiencies within the CCG organization
  • Manage client deliverables including reporting requirements (performance and operational reporting, commentaries) and other service needs as identified by the client
  • Navigate the organization internally and collaborate across teams including business and operations to resolve client queries in a timely fashion
  • Respond to information requests from clients including information questionnaires, audit requests, and ad-hoc and recurring client inquiries
  • Develop a strong awareness of client interests and investment trends coupled with the intellectual curiosity to explore and research those areas to best deliver the resources of the firm to our clients
